[ Upstream commit2f09707d0c] Cong Wang noticed that the previous fix for sch_sfb accessing the queued skb after enqueueing it to a child qdisc was incomplete: the SFB enqueue function was also calling qdisc_qstats_backlog_inc() after enqueue, which reads the pkt len from the skb cb field. Fix this by also storing the skb len, and using the stored value to increment the backlog after enqueueing.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
